Infected with FunWebProducts Spyware?

Remove FunWebProducts (Link includes removal instructions) I’ve started looking over my “Referrer” logs, and noticed something that caught my eye. It’s the string “Mozilla/4.0 (compatible; MSIE 6.0; Windows NT 5.1; SV1; FunWebProducts)”, and specifically “FunWebProducts”. A little research revealed this to be a common spyware tag.
